Output 17c99595a75306172895c1fc6e9280a4a329fce07b58982bf9992abb4fb0fe69:0

value
1668082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 393f455708c95a2936b5b1522896dae89356d2ff OP_EQUAL
address
36uiEcbJHFFFChzS7NuCN9dk292RVJXr6y
transaction
17c99595a75306172895c1fc6e9280a4a329fce07b58982bf9992abb4fb0fe69
spent
true